Nature’s Treasure Chest: Herbs and Their Wonders
What Your Kid will Experience:
Learn about the herbs and it's value
Grind the herbs with mortar and pestel with the guidance of an instructor.
They will enjoy hands on experience in making a herbal concoction called kashayam or kada and will learn the term in multiple regional languages.
They will also get to taste the concoction.
Sweet Traditions: Learn to Make Festive Modaks
What Your Kid will Experience
Kids will learn and understand the interesting traditional stories associated with modak making.
Kids will make the modak and cook the same under the guidance of instructors.
They will take home an amazing experience learning about our culture and culinary delight along with a mould to make modaks at home.
All materials will be provided
